OVERACHIEVER

As the crowd erupted in a frenzy after Jully fell to the ground, Ken, visibly exhausted, called out, "Anyone else up to challenge me?" But after witnessing his fight, no one in their right mind would dare step forward. Ken, drained from the intense battle, sat down on the ground, waiting for the King's Duel to officially conclude, where he would be crowned the new ruler of Lionheart Kingdom.

An official representative from the KISEN domain had arrived to oversee the coronation, and Ken, despite his injuries from the fight with Jully, prepared himself for the ceremony. Meanwhile, someone in the crowd, biting their nails in frustration, couldn't hide their growing hatred toward Ken. As this person simmered in anger, a strange man approached and asked, "Do you wish to defeat him?"

Determined to see Ken fall, the individual accepted without hesitation. The strange man performed an eerie mantra, and suddenly, the person began twitching uncontrollably, their body contorting as they transformed into a demon.

The sun set, and the King's Ascension ceremony began. The KISEN official, standing before Ken, presented the crown. With a solemn air, Ken was crowned king of Lionheart Kingdom, the crowd cheering wildly for their new ruler.

In the upper cosmic sea, many beings watched this event unfold. Some were pleased, while others were not. Among them, a mysterious woman smiled to herself, saying, "As expected of that man's reincarnation. Even without your memories, you're still that overachieving one, aren't you, Ken?"

Far away, in the Kingdom of Crimson Light, screams echoed through the royal chambers. "You—You! Stay away from me!" The person speaking was none other than the Martial General of the Crimson Paladins, the most powerful army in the KISEN domain. "Please spare me—me!" the general begged before a young boy.

The boy looked down on him coldly, his voice emotionless. "No one is worthy of fighting me equally." Suddenly, a bird flew toward him with a note in its beak. The boy took it and read the message. It spoke of the new king of Lionheart Kingdom: King Ken. The boy's lips curved into a small, sinister smile. "Interesting. Very interesting. I may have to pay him a visit."

Meanwhile, in Lionheart's royal office, Ken sat amidst an overwhelming pile of paperwork, his face twisted in frustration. With an exasperated scream, he shouted, "I didn't sign up for thisssssss!"

Though now king, Ken quickly realized that the burden of leadership came with a mountain of administrative duties. But as challenges loomed on the horizon, both in his kingdom and beyond, his path as the ruler of Lionheart was just beginning.
